2011-08146 In the Matter of Anjelika Hejna, et al., appellants, v Board of Appeals of Village of Amityville, et al., respondents. (Index No. 29063/07) 2011-08149 In the Matter of Anjelika Hejna, et al., appellants, v Planning Board of Village of Amityville, et al., respondents. (Index No. 214/09)
| D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ION |
Separate motions by the respondent Jamm Holding, Inc., to dismiss appeals from two orders of the Supreme Court, Suffolk County, both dated June 6, 2011, on the ground that they have been rendered academic. Cross motion by the appellant for a preference in the calendaring of the appeals.
Upon the papers filed in support of the motions and the cross motion, and the papers filed in opposition thereto, it is
ORDERED that the motions are held in abeyance and referred to the panel of Justices hearing the appeals for determination upon the argument or submission thereof; and it is further,
ORDERED that the cross motion is denied.
ANGIOLILLO, J.P., BALKIN, LOTT and ROMAN, JJ., concur.
